Post Burn Cubital Tunnel Syndrome Response to High Intensity Laser Therapy Versus Shock Wave Therapy
NCT: NCT07102992 · COMPLETED
Brief Summary
Significant morbidity in burn patients occurs frequently because of Post burn nerve entrapment syndromes. Nerve entrapment arises due to direct compression because of edema; they may also present due to scar tissue formation. Burns of the forearm and elbow are associated with swelling, redness and pain. In second to third-degree burns, the eschar forms a tight band constricting the circulation distally and forms edema that leads to compression neuropathy of ulnar nerve. Also the hyper metabolic response of the burned patients, has been suggested as a cause of the peripheral neuropathies, as the basal metabolic rate (B.M.R) of the burned patients increase more than 2 to 2.5 times normal.
